About the Book

The Thin Blue Line invites you on a deeply personal exploration of climate change, the ozone layer, and global warming. Challenge everything you think you know about the environment through a journey that blends scientific inquiry with personal storytelling. This book questions media-driven narratives, offering a fresh perspective on what's happening to our planet. Travelling from the scorching sun of rural Australia to the melting glaciers of Canada, Skybourne explores the fragility and resilience of nature along the way. Reflect on what you truly believe about climate change as you engage in thought-provoking conversations about the environment's future. What's in the Book: Questions: What do You Believe? Start by reflecting on your beliefs about climate change, as the opening chapter encourages you to challenge mainstream narratives. Delve into personal experiences that shape an understanding of environmental issues, urging you to think critically about what you know and why. What We're Told vs. What We See Explore the differences between media narratives and real-life environmental changes. Investigate how global stories on climate change don't always align with personal or regional experiences, especially in areas like Australia, Canada, and Southeast Asia. Australia's Cycles of Destruction and Renewal Observe how Australia's extreme climate leads to cycles of destruction and renewal. Question whether these patterns are evidence of global climate change or simply nature's rhythm. Discover how extreme conditions influence the perspective on environmental change. Canada's Frozen North and Melting Glaciers Travel to Canada and witness the shrinking glaciers for yourself. Reflect on how these changes align with the broader global narrative about climate change while considering nature's resilience and the real message behind these transformations. How the Media Shapes Our Beliefs Examine the media's powerful role in shaping public perception of climate change. Consider how alarmist narratives may distort your understanding of global warming. Engage with critical thinking as you evaluate the information you consume. A Personal Reckoning with the Ozone Layer Reconnect with the issue of ozone layer depletion and reflect on its personal and global significance. Understand why ozone recovery remains a key environmental concern and explore how collective efforts offer hope for the future. The Global Perspective Across Continents Venture through Europe, Asia, and the United States to compare environmental challenges and perspectives. See the complexity and diversity of global environmental issues, from Europe's balanced landscapes to Southeast Asia's industrial struggles. Media Misinformation and the Battle for Belief Break down the rise of misinformation and scepticism surrounding climate change. Step outside your echo chamber and explore how to find balanced, well-informed perspectives on these complex and often oversimplified issues. Engage on a Journey Through the Climate Debate Conclude by engaging with the larger climate debate, reflecting on your journey through the book. Challenge your own beliefs and the narratives you encounter, making informed decisions about the planet's future. What do you believe? If you've ever questioned what's real and what's exaggerated in the climate change debate, a fresh perspective that encourages critical thought and self-reflection. Understand the climate crisis's complexity and clarify your beliefs amidst overwhelming narratives about the environment.
